No skin, as stated fillet them down the back flip and run the knife between the meat and skin. We never had an issue with freezing as long as it wasn’t for too many days, like less than 2 weeks.
I dont freeze fish too often and never have vac-paked them. I would take qt size freezer bags and fill them to 3/4 full of fillets. Put some water in and squeeze the air out. When the water is about to overflow I seal the bag. The fillets should be surrounded by the water so there is no chance of freezer burn. You may have to adjust the amount of water. I have eaten fish up to 2 yrs later and all is good.Can you elaborate? I was going to hit the blue cats hard this year and vacu-bag and freeze.
